My experience with the Sage is that it uses standard ports. I did
not have to do anything to the company firewall to make it
work. Mine is currently polling Washington State's CAP server, not
FEMA's so I suppose there could be a difference there.

>I'm trying to determine what firewall changes I will need to make
>for CAP IP traffic when I move from our legacy EAS equipment (with
>no internet connection) to CAP compatible equipment. Does CAP us
>any of the standard IP protocols and ports (such as HTTP via port 80
>or SMTP via port 25), or do non-standard ports have to be
>configured? Will this vary between equipment manufacturers, or will
>the port addresses be determined by the CAP server?
